PROCEDURE
实验过程
60% Sodium hydride in oil (2.4 g) was added portion-wise to a stirred solution of 1-[4-(1,1,2,2-tetrafluoroethoxy)phenyl]-2(1H,3H)-imidazolone (16.6 g) and the resulting mixture was stirred for 30 minutes at room temperature. (2R,3S)-2-(2,4-Difluorophenyl)-3-methyl-2-(1H-1,2,4-triazol-1-yl)methyloxirane (10 g) was added and the mixture was stirred at 80° C. for 20 hours. After cooling, the mixture was concentrated into a volume of about 50 ml under reduced pressure and diluted ice-water (400 ml) and ethyl acetate (500 ml). The ethyl acetate layer was separated, washed with a 10% aqueous phosphoric acid solution (400 ml) and an aqueous solution of sodium chloride (400 ml×2) successively and dried over anhydrous magnesium sulfate. The solvent was distilled off under reduced pressure and the residue was purified by silica gel column chromatography (eluent: hexane/ethyl acetate=1/1 to 2/1) to give 1-[(1R,2R)-2-(2,4-difluorophenyl)-2-hydroxy-1-methyl-3-(1H-1,2,4-triazol-1-yl)propyl]-3-[4-(1,1,2,2-tetrafluoroethoxy)phenyl]-2(1H,3H)-imidazolone (7.56 g) as an oily substance, which was identical with the compound obtained in the Reference Example 47.
